James David Smillie, American, (1833–1909) . At Marblehead Neck, 1883. Etching on wove paper with gilt edges. plate : 126 x 301 mm (5 x 11.9 in.). DAC accession number 1987.3.18. Gift of George W. Davison (BA Wesleyan 1892); Print Reference Library transfer, 1987.
